The Origins of the Series
The series was inspired by real-life events and the struggles of the British youth. The creators, Jack Thorne and Stephen Graham, drew from their own experiences and observations of the issues affecting young people in Britain. They aimed to shed light on the complexities of masculinity and the societal pressures that contribute to violent behavior. • The series explores the theme of toxic masculinity, which is often perpetuated by societal norms and expectations placed on boys and men.

The Impact of Rejection on Adolescents
Rejection from peers can have a profound impact on an adolescent’s emotional and psychological well-being. The adolescent brain is still developing, and the prefrontal cortex, which is responsible for planning and making good decisions, is not yet fully mature.

The Importance of Digital Literacy Education
Digital literacy education is essential for boys to navigate the online world safely and responsibly. This includes teaching them how to identify and report online threats, how to use social media effectively, and how to maintain online safety and security.

Encouraging Healthy Attitudes Towards Women in the Digital Age
The Importance of Parental Guidance
Parents play a vital role in shaping their children’s attitudes towards women. In today’s digital age, where social media and online platforms dominate the lives of teenagers, it is more crucial than ever for parents to be involved in their children’s online activities. • They can help their children develop a positive and respectful attitude towards women by engaging in open and honest conversations about the importance of consent, boundaries, and respect. • Parents can also help their children recognize and challenge online harassment and sexism by modeling healthy behaviors and encouraging their children to do the same.
